Also, don’t use an extension cord as a power source as it would be a code violation. You’ll need 18 inches above the washer if it is a top-loading model so you can open its door. Also, allow for one inch on each side of the appliances. Most machines are 33 inches, but add six inches for hoses and venting. If your washer and dryer are side by side, you’ll need a horizontal space of 60 inches or five feet. Also, laundry room doors need to be a minimum of 32 inches wide. If your laundry room is on the second floor, your stairwell must be wide enough to carry the washing machine and dryer upstairs.Ī width of 45 inches is necessary to make a 90-degree turn when carrying the appliances upstairs. The entryway to your home must be wide enough for you to move your washer and dryer in and out of your home. If you don’t, you will have problems when you want to sell your home. If you want to build a utility room, follow the requirements and specifications. Laundry rooms must follow codes that help prevent accidents and reduce fire risk.
